Are you interested in publishing your research in an academic journal but you're not sure how to start the process? The Kraemer Family Library is offering a workshop series for new faculty and graduate students who are interested in understanding the entire publishing process. Our four-part workshop series will address the life-cycle of scholarly publishing and open access, the editorial and submission process, understanding copyright, and how to track your impact after you have published.

The Wonderful World of Publishing will include information about: the lifecycle of scholarly publishing, open access and why you should care, and how to fund your publication.
